Tomo Aizawa
Tomo Aizawa is the heart and soul of the series. She's a tomboy through and through, known for her strength, outgoing personality, and unwavering loyalty to her friends. Growing up, Tomo was always one of the guys, which is why she's now facing a bit of a dilemma. She's head-over-heels for her childhood best friend, Junichirou Kubota, but he just sees her as one of the bros. Tomo's journey is all about trying to break free from this perception and show Jun that she's not just a buddy, but a girl who's totally into him. Her character development is a rollercoaster of hilarious misunderstandings, awkward situations, and heartwarming moments.
One of the most endearing aspects of Tomo is her determination. Despite facing constant rejection from Jun, she never gives up on her goal. She tries everything from dressing more femininely to learning how to cook, all in an effort to catch his eye. However, her efforts often backfire in comical ways, highlighting her genuine and somewhat clumsy nature. Tomo's physical strength is another defining trait. She's incredibly athletic and can easily overpower most of the guys in her class, which further cements her tomboy image. This strength, while impressive, also adds to her struggle to be seen as a girl. She often finds herself in situations where she has to choose between being true to herself and conforming to societal expectations of femininity.
Despite her tough exterior, Tomo has a vulnerable side. She cares deeply about her friends and is always there to support them, even when she's dealing with her own romantic frustrations. Her relationships with Misuzu and Carol are particularly important, as they provide her with much-needed advice and encouragement. Tomo's emotional growth throughout the series is significant. She learns to accept herself for who she is, while also understanding that it's okay to want to be seen as attractive to the person she loves. Her journey is relatable to anyone who's ever felt like they didn't quite fit in or struggled to express their true feelings. Tomo Aizawa is not just a character; she's a symbol of embracing individuality and pursuing love with unwavering spirit.
Junichirou Kubota
Junichirou Kubota, or Jun as he's often called, is Tomo's longtime best friend and the object of her affection. He's a laid-back and easygoing guy who, for the longest time, has only seen Tomo as one of his male buddies. Jun is athletic, popular, and generally well-liked, but he's also a bit dense when it comes to romantic feelings, especially those directed at him by Tomo. His obliviousness is a major source of comedy in the series, as Tomo tries everything to get him to see her as a girl, only for her efforts to fly right over his head. However, as the story progresses, Jun starts to realize that his feelings for Tomo might be more complicated than he initially thought. This realization sets him on his own journey of self-discovery and understanding his true emotions.
One of Jun's defining characteristics is his loyalty to his friends. He's always there for Tomo and the rest of their group, whether they need a shoulder to cry on or someone to join them in their latest crazy adventure. He values his friendships and is always willing to go the extra mile to support those he cares about. This loyalty is particularly evident in his interactions with Tomo. Even though he doesn't initially see her as a romantic interest, he deeply values her friendship and is always there to protect her. Jun's athletic abilities also play a significant role in his character. He's a skilled martial artist, just like Tomo, and the two often engage in friendly sparring matches. These matches are not only a display of their physical prowess but also a reflection of their close bond and competitive spirit.
As Jun begins to recognize his feelings for Tomo, his character undergoes a subtle but significant transformation. He starts to pay more attention to her appearance and behavior, noticing the little things he never did before. He also becomes more aware of the way other guys look at her, sparking a sense of protectiveness and jealousy. This internal conflict is a key part of his development, as he grapples with the idea of seeing his best friend as someone he could potentially have a romantic relationship with. Junichirou Kubota's journey is one of awakening and self-discovery, as he learns to navigate the complexities of love and friendship. His evolution from a clueless best friend to a potential romantic partner is both heartwarming and humorous, making him a compelling character to watch.
Misuzu Gundou
Misuzu Gundou is one of Tomo's closest friends, known for her sharp wit, sarcastic remarks, and cool demeanor. She often acts as the voice of reason in the group, providing Tomo with advice and a reality check when needed. Misuzu has a dry sense of humor and isn't afraid to speak her mind, which can sometimes come across as harsh, but she genuinely cares about her friends. She has a long history with Tomo and Jun, having known them since childhood, which gives her a unique perspective on their relationship dynamics. Misuzu's character is complex, as she often hides her true feelings behind a mask of sarcasm and indifference.
One of Misuzu's defining traits is her intelligence. She's a top student and excels in academics, often tutoring her friends when they need help. Her intelligence extends beyond academics, as she's also very perceptive and can quickly analyze situations and people. This makes her an excellent advisor to Tomo, who often relies on Misuzu's insights to navigate her romantic pursuits. However, Misuzu's intelligence can also be a double-edged sword. She sometimes overthinks things and can be overly critical of herself and others. Her sarcastic nature is another key aspect of her personality. She uses sarcasm as a defense mechanism, often making witty remarks to deflect attention from her own emotions. While her sarcasm can be amusing, it can also create distance between her and others. Despite her tough exterior, Misuzu has a vulnerable side. She cares deeply about her friends and is always there for them, even if she doesn't always show it. Her loyalty to Tomo is unwavering, and she's always willing to go the extra mile to support her, even if it means putting herself in uncomfortable situations.
As the series progresses, Misuzu's character undergoes a subtle transformation. She starts to open up more to her friends, revealing her true feelings and vulnerabilities. She also learns to let go of her inhibitions and embrace her own desires. Her journey is one of self-acceptance and emotional growth, as she learns to be more honest with herself and others. Misuzu Gundou is a complex and multifaceted character who brings depth and nuance to the series. Her sharp wit, intelligence, and hidden vulnerabilities make her a compelling and relatable character to watch.
Carol Olston
Carol Olston is another of Tomo's close friends, known for her cheerful personality, airheaded tendencies, and unwavering optimism. She's the quintessential genki girl, always bringing energy and enthusiasm to the group. Carol is also incredibly naive and often misunderstands situations, leading to hilarious misunderstandings. Despite her airheadedness, Carol is genuinely kind and caring, always looking out for her friends and trying to make them happy. She has a unique perspective on the world, often seeing things in a way that others don't, which can sometimes be surprisingly insightful.
One of Carol's defining traits is her innocence. She's incredibly pure and naive, often taking things at face value without questioning them. This innocence can be both endearing and frustrating, as she sometimes fails to grasp the complexities of social situations. However, her innocence also allows her to see the good in everyone and to approach life with a sense of wonder and optimism. Carol's cheerful personality is another key aspect of her character. She's always smiling and laughing, spreading joy and positivity wherever she goes. Her infectious enthusiasm can lift the spirits of those around her, even in the most challenging situations. Despite her airheadedness, Carol is surprisingly perceptive. She has a knack for sensing when her friends are upset or need help, and she's always there to offer a comforting word or a helping hand. Her intuition often guides her in unexpected ways, leading her to make surprisingly insightful observations.
As the series progresses, Carol's character undergoes a subtle transformation. She starts to become more aware of the world around her, gaining a better understanding of social dynamics and human emotions. She also learns to embrace her own strengths and to use her unique perspective to help others. Her journey is one of growth and self-discovery, as she learns to navigate the complexities of life while maintaining her cheerful and optimistic spirit. Carol Olston is a delightful and endearing character who brings a sense of joy and innocence to the series. Her cheerful personality, airheaded tendencies, and unwavering optimism make her a lovable and memorable character.
